Long title
An Act to implement the Republic of Vanuatu’s obligations as a party to the Convention on International Trade in Endangered Species of Wild Fauna and Flora signed at Washington on 3 March 1973 by controlling and regulating the exportation and importation of certain species of fauna and flora, and for related purposes.

Abstract

This Act provides rules for the trade from and to Vanuatu of endangered species of plants and animals as defined by the Convention on International Trade in Endangered Species of Wild Fauna and Flora and in particular international trade in Appendix I specimen, Appendix II specimen and Appendix III specimen.
